    Need help buying a smart plug

    RMS, for an electrical measurement, is the DC equivalent of AC. The formal definition goes something like for a purely resistive load, if an AC is applied across it, the DC required to produce an equivalent amount of power dissipation is the RMS (root mean square). Think of it like a fancy average.

    Need help buying a smart plug

    The polycab smart plugs are calculating RMS. They are equipped with BL0937 chip, which does RMS voltage and current, as well as active power calculation. As for experimental proof, here's my polycab 10A plug connected to my server, tested from mains and UPS.
